White House Press Pool Reports @WHPressPool - EXECUTIVE ORDER
PROMOTING RETIREMENT-SAVINGS ACCESS FOR AMERICAN WORKERS BY EDTABLISHING http://TRUMPIRA.GOV
By the authority vested in me as President by the Constitution and the laws of the United States of America, and to ensure that every American worker has access to a simple, portable, low-cost retirement-savings option, it is hereby ordered:
Section 1. Policy. Tens of millions of Americans lack access to employer-sponsored retirement plans. Workers in small businesses, part-time workers, independent contractors, and self‑employed workers face unnecessary barriers to saving for retirement. My Administration intends to give these often-left-out American workers access to the same type of retirement-savings opportunities offered to every Federal worker and to establish an easy and transparent way for eligible workers to obtain up to a $1,000 match for their savings. Hard-working Americans deserve retirement security in portable savings vehicles that offer access to low-cost investments similar to those offered to Federal workers in the Thrift Savings Plan.
It is the policy of the United States to promote high-quality, low-cost individual retirement accounts (IRAs) offered by private-sector financial institutions that meet objective standards of cost, transparency, and fiduciary responsibility.
It is further the policy of the United States to increase public awareness of the Federal Saver's Match enacted in the bipartisan SECURE 2.0 Act (Public Law 117-328, Division T) and to facilitate participation in eligible retirement-savings vehicles that provide diversified, index-based investment options.
Through a federally administered retirement-savings informational platform that highlights qualifying high-quality, low-cost, private-sector IRAs, the United States will promote retirement-savings participation, provide access to retirement-savings options similar to those enjoyed by Federal employees, and encourage workers to reap the rewards of the vibrant American private-sector along with the power of compound earnings.
Sec. 2. Establishment of https://trumpira.gov. (a) The Secretary of the Treasury shall, by January 1, 2027, establish a website (https://trumpira.gov) that provides individuals, with a particular focus on independent contractors, self-employed individuals, and other workers who do not have access to an employer-sponsored retirement plan, with information about high-quality, low-cost IRAs. Individuals who contribute to qualifying IRAs, and who are otherwise eligible, are entitled to a Federal Saver's Match contribution of up to $1,000 pursuant to 26 U.S.C. 6433.
(b) https://trumpira.gov shall list financial institutions that offer IRAs under 26 U.S.C. 408, accept the Federal Saver's Match contribution under 26 U.S.C. 6433(e)(2)(C), and meet other criteria, as directed by the Secretary of the Treasury, consistent with applicable law. In addition, https://trumpira.gov shall explain the cost and quality criteria described in subsection (c) of this section, allow individuals to filter and select IRAs based on their cost and quality, and provide information regarding the opportunity to receive the Federal Saver's Match contribution under 26 U.S.C. 6433, consistent with applicable law.
